Will using non-GamStop sites impact my credit score?

Using betting platforms not on GamStop will not directly impact your credit score, as gambling transactions are not reported to credit reference agencies in the same way as loans or credit card applications. Your credit score is determined by factors such as payment history on credit accounts, outstanding debts, credit utilization, and credit applications, none of which are directly influenced by online betting activity. However, there are indirect ways gambling could potentially affect your creditworthiness. If gambling leads to financial difficulties that result in missed payments on credit cards, loans, or bills, those missed payments would negatively impact your credit score. Additionally, if you use credit cards or loans to fund gambling activities and accumulate debt, high credit utilization or defaults could harm your credit rating. Some mortgage lenders and loan providers may review bank statements during application processes and could view excessive gambling transactions as a risk factor, though this relates to lending decisions rather than credit scores themselves.
